Only New-Zealand fusion company. Pursues a levitated-dipole reactor (a superconducting ring suspended in vacuum) inspired by Jupiter's magnetosphere — naturally turbulence-suppressing and well-suited to advanced fuels.
Thesis: A dipole field is the cleanest confinement nature has ever demonstrated (Jupiter's radiation belts). Engineer it on Earth and advanced fuels become accessible.
Key engineering bottlenecks: Levitation reliability of HTS ring; Heat exhaust from a closed-flux geometry.
Recent milestones: 2024 — First plasma in 'Junior' demonstrator.
